CVE-2013-5150

N/A Unknown
Published: September 19, 2013 Modified: April 29, 2026
View on NVD

Description

The history-clearing feature in Safari in Apple iOS before 7 does not clear the back/forward history of an open tab, which allows physically proximate attackers to obtain sensitive information by leveraging an unattended workstation.
